Far-infrared spectrum of poly(p-phenylene terephthalamide)

Abstract
The polarized and unpolarized far-infrared (460-30 cm−1) spectra of poly(p-phenylene terephthalamide) (PPTA) fabric and fiber arrays are reported. These spectra are discussed and tentatively analyzed on the basis of the internal and external modes of the repeat unit of PPTA. To assist in band assignments, the spectra of potassium triiodide-treated PPTA fibers and of benzanilide and its benzene solution are also reported.
